What you'll do:
You will be responsible for driving sales and profitability through effective planning, management, and analysis of merchandise across retail and online. Working across channels and functions, you will play a key role in optimising product assortments, pricing strategies, and promotional activities to meet customer demand and achieve business objectives.
What you’ll be doing:
- Collaborate with buying teams to develop and implement seasonal range plans, ensuring alignment with market trends, customer preferences, and financial targets.
- Monitor stock levels, sales performance, and product replenishment to optimise inventory turnover, minimise stockouts, and reduce excess inventory.
- Utilise sales data, historical trends, and market insights to forecast demand, identify opportunities, and mitigate risks.
- Develop pricing strategies, markdown plans, and promotional campaigns to maximise sales and margin while maintaining competitive positioning.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including marketing, operations, and finance, to align merchandising efforts with broader business objectives and initiatives
- Working alongside the merchandising team to plan and develop strategies including budgets and option planning
